The Epiphone Ultra has the "belly cut" and is also chambered making it 3 to 4 pounds lighter than a regular Standard. It's a great sounding guitar and a wonderful player. By the way, I am talking about the Ultra and not the Ultra II which is essentially the same guitar with a Nanomag pickup that produces a sort of scoustic tone. There have been reports of issues with that particular instrument ... so you might want to avoid that one.
